Thanks to your generous support and donations, ADVCL was able to provide advocacy and referrals to 33 survivors (21 of whom were new callers) from or on behalf of 28 different families (19 of whom were new) in March 2009. We received 93 calls, emails and faxes from 14 different countries.
In March 2009, ADVCL also expanded its global reach and received calls from three new countries: Kyrgyzstan, Iraq, and Nicaragua. An important part of ADVCL’s mission is to reach survivors around the world and let them know they are not alone.
Also in March, ADVCL provided relocation assistance to two families. Many survivors overseas are physically and financially isolated, and sometimes forced to flee without their children. In March, ADVCL reunited a mother with her four children whom she was forced to leave behind in the Middle East in order to escape to the US. We also assisted a mother with having visitation with her daughter who, because of a custody hearing, remains in Europe.
